Errbit logo Errbit

The open source error catcher that's Airbrake API compliant

RAML logo RAML

RAML is a solution that manages an API lifecycle from design to sharing.

  • What is Developer Experience and why should we care?
    Provide consistent and easy-to-use documentation. Provide an OpenAPI or RAML file that describes your API and the endpoints. Also, provide easy-to-use interactive online API documentation like Swagger if possible. - Source: dev.to / almost 3 years ago
